How to make mint and parsley omelette
Originally Lebanese dish of 'iggit el na' na' wa el baqdounis. Hope the guide sparks some ideas ☺

Prepare your parsley and mint leaves. Finely chopped
Prepare 2 big eggs. Some recipe calls for 4 eggs along with a cup of chopped parsley and mint, well I like more leaves though 😝
Not just kosher salt, but I added kosher salt mix and this time is lime and celery mix for fragrant and tangy kick
Add in some white pepper. I like it 1/2 tsp only
Whisk to combine all of the spice conponent. Taste before adding the leaves in
Add in the chopped parsley and mint leaves
Preheat a saucepan and add in some olive oil
The original recipe said to spoon to hot oil to make small omelettes, but I like it this way ☺
Flip it once ...
.... and twice .... now cook until it is golden brown
Your side dish is done! Just try it and according to my palette, the taste is absolutely there ☺. Enjoy!
- 1/2c parsley leaves, finely chopped
- 1/2c mint leaves, finely chopped
- 2.0 eggs, big ones
- salt and pepper
- olive oil for frying
